Gladstone Yacht Club

Fresh Seafood Delights

Given its coastal location, it's no surprise that Gladstone is renowned for its fresh seafood offerings. The city's proximity to the Southern Great Barrier Reef means that diners have access to some of the freshest seafood in Queensland. Local restaurants and eateries take full advantage of this by offering menus filled with delicious seafood dishes that showcase the region's natural bounty.

Gladstone Yacht Club: Overlooking the beautiful Gladstone Marina, the Gladstone Yacht Club is a popular choice for those seeking fresh seafood with a view. The restaurant features an extensive menu of seafood dishes, including succulent prawns, mud crabs, and reef fish, all sourced locally. Diners can enjoy these fresh offerings while relaxing in a laid-back atmosphere with stunning waterfront views. The Yacht Club is also known for its live music events and weekend specials, making it a great spot to unwind and enjoy the best of Gladstone's dining scene.

Auckland House: Another fantastic option for seafood lovers, Auckland House is a waterfront bar and restaurant that combines a relaxed vibe with an emphasis on fresh, local ingredients. Their menu includes a variety of seafood dishes, such as salt and pepper calamari, grilled barramundi, and seafood platters perfect for sharing. Auckland House also offers a great selection of craft beers brewed on-site, making it a popular choice for both food and drink enthusiasts.

Modern Australian Cuisine and Fine Dining

For those looking to indulge in modern Australian cuisine or fine dining, Gladstone has several restaurants that offer an elevated dining experience. These establishments focus on using locally sourced ingredients, creative presentations, and a mix of traditional and contemporary flavors to deliver memorable meals.

Lightbox Espresso & Wine Bar: Located in the heart of Gladstone, Lightbox Espresso & Wine Bar is a trendy and modern dining spot that offers a fusion of contemporary Australian cuisine with a touch of international influence. Known for its stylish decor and ambient atmosphere, Lightbox serves up delicious dishes like crispy pork belly, slow-cooked lamb shoulder, and a variety of vegetarian options. The restaurant also boasts an extensive wine list and craft cocktails, making it an excellent choice for a romantic dinner or a night out with friends.

Rocksalt Bar & Restaurant: Rocksalt is a favorite among locals and visitors alike for its creative menu and emphasis on fresh, seasonal ingredients. The restaurant offers a diverse selection of dishes, from tender steaks and seafood risottos to unique vegetarian creations. Rocksalt's attention to detail in both flavor and presentation sets it apart, providing a fine dining experience that is both sophisticated and welcoming. The restaurant's location in the Gladstone CBD makes it a convenient choice for those staying in the city center.

Casual Dining and Family-Friendly Restaurants

For a more casual dining experience, Gladstone offers numerous family-friendly restaurants and eateries that provide great food in a relaxed environment. These spots are perfect for a laid-back meal with family or friends after a day of exploring the city.

The Precinct Café: Situated in the East Shores precinct, The Precinct Café is a popular choice for families and groups looking for a casual dining option with a view. The café serves a variety of breakfast, lunch, and dinner options, including hearty burgers, fresh salads, and classic fish and chips. With its outdoor seating and proximity to the waterfront, The Precinct Café provides a pleasant setting for a relaxed meal or coffee break while enjoying the ocean breeze.

Hog's Breath Café: Known for its fun, laid-back atmosphere and generous portions, Hog's Breath Café is a great choice for families and those looking for a classic Australian steakhouse experience. The menu includes a variety of steaks, burgers, ribs, and seafood, all prepared with Hog's Breath's signature seasoning and cooking techniques. The restaurant's friendly service and casual vibe make it a favorite among locals and visitors alike.

International Flavors and Global Cuisines

Gladstone's dining scene is also a reflection of its diverse community, with a variety of international restaurants offering flavors from around the world. Whether you're in the mood for Asian, Italian, or Indian cuisine, you're sure to find something that satisfies your cravings.

The Brass Bell: The Brass Bell is an Italian restaurant located in Gladstone that brings a taste of Italy to the coast of Queensland. Known for its wood-fired pizzas, homemade pasta dishes, and fresh seafood, The Brass Bell offers a warm and inviting dining experience. The restaurant also features an extensive wine list, including both local and imported options, making it a perfect choice for a cozy dinner with family or friends.

Indian Hut: For those who love the rich flavors and spices of Indian cuisine, Indian Hut is a must-visit. This restaurant offers a range of traditional Indian dishes, including butter chicken, lamb rogan josh, and vegetarian curries, all prepared using authentic recipes and fresh ingredients. The friendly service and warm atmosphere make it a popular spot for both dine-in and takeaway.

Thai Basement: Another excellent option for international cuisine is Thai Basement, which specializes in traditional Thai dishes with a modern twist. The menu includes favorites like pad Thai, green curry, and Thai basil stir fry, as well as a selection of unique dishes inspired by Thai street food. With its relaxed atmosphere and flavorful dishes, Thai Basement is a great place to enjoy a taste of Thailand in the heart of Gladstone.

Cozy Cafes and Breakfast Spots

Gladstone's café culture is alive and well, with numerous spots offering delicious breakfasts, artisanal coffees, and light lunches. These cafes provide the perfect setting for a morning pick-me-up or a leisurely brunch with friends.

Fresh Fix Café: Located in the Gladstone CBD, Fresh Fix Café is a favorite among locals for its laid-back vibe and delicious breakfast offerings. The café serves a variety of breakfast options, from classic avocado toast and eggs benedict to more unique dishes like chorizo scrambled eggs and smoothie bowls. Fresh Fix Café also prides itself on its freshly brewed coffee and selection of house-made cakes and pastries, making it a great place to start your day.

Flavourin Café: Situated near the Gladstone Marina, Flavourin Café offers a cozy and welcoming atmosphere with views of the water. The café's menu features a range of breakfast and lunch options, including fresh salads, sandwiches, and hearty wraps. With its friendly service and relaxing setting, Flavourin Café is an ideal spot to enjoy a leisurely meal or coffee break.

Bars and Pubs for a Night Out

The Grand Hotel: The Grand Hotel is one of Gladstone's most iconic pubs, known for its lively atmosphere, great drinks, and regular live music events. The pub features a traditional bar menu with options like steaks, burgers, and schnitzels, as well as a range of beers on tap and craft cocktails. With its central location and vibrant ambiance, The Grand Hotel is a popular choice for a night out in Gladstone.

Dicey's Bar and Grill: Located in the heart of Gladstone, Dicey's Bar and Grill offers a fun and relaxed atmosphere with a menu of classic pub favorites and daily specials. The bar also features live entertainment, trivia nights, and themed events, making it a great spot to unwind and enjoy some local hospitality.
